Hi everyone, I have been a member of the forum for some years but this is my first post.

I have recently obtained from an older brother the Dexta that my father bought in the early to mid 60s. I don't know exactly when it was bought but do have fond memories of driving it in my early teens on the family orchard.
I also received the original owners manual with it.

I live on the Mornington Peninsula in Victoria , Australia.

The tractor is a light blue Dexta with grey grill, guards and wheels. It does run but needs a lot of tlc after being parked in a shed for a number of years. The radiator is fairly bad, the nose cone has rust across the bottom (from the leaking radiator) and there is some rust in the mudguards.

When I work out how, I will post some photos of its original state, and improvements that I am making.
